The Allure of Coventry Living Coventry is a city with a captivating blend of tradition and modernity. Its historical significance, including the majestic Coventry Cathedral and the ruins of St. Michael's Cathedral, adds a touch of grandeur to its landscape. Moreover, the city has undergone significant regeneration efforts, resulting in a thriving economy, world-class educational institutions, and an impressive cultural scene. Coventry's strong transport links, including its proximity to major motorways and a direct train service to London, make it an attractive location for commuters as well.

Q3: Are there any good schools in Coventry?
A3: Coventry boasts several outstanding schools and educational institutions, both in the state and private sectors. Areas such as Earlsdon and Allesley are known for their excellent primary and secondary schools, providing quality education options for families.
Q4: What amenities and attractions does Coventry offer?
A4: Coventry provides a wide range of amenities, including shopping centers, restaurants, cultural venues, and recreational spaces. Key attractions include Coventry Cathedral, the Herbert Art Gallery and Museum, Ricoh Arena, and the Coventry Transport Museum, among others.
